    Political Global fast-food firms must comply with country-specific political requirements, such as national minimum wage regulations, affecting costs. Hygiene and quality regulations vary significantly between nations and may influence the quality of products provided by fast-food outlets (FDA, 2012). Different countries set varying regulations regarding labelling and packaging. For instance the UK government pressured firms to promote healthy eating, and several fast-food companies have voluntarily included calorie information on their products (BBC, 2011).
